There are 9 Neighborhood residence states: Arizona, California, Idaho, Louisiana, Nevada, New Mexico, Texas, Washington and Wisconsin. If you reside in one of these states, your spouse’s earnings and assets might be viewed as in deciding just how much of your debt it is best to repay. Your helpful hints bankruptcy discharge eradicates your obligation to pay for your dischargeable independent debts and joint debts. Your discharge doesn't have an affect on your spouse's accountability towards any joint debts.
